Essential Skills for Mastering Clinical Data Analytics
To excel in the field of clinical data analytics, professionals need to possess a blend of technical and interpersonal skills. Here are some key competencies that the certificate program aims to develop:
1. Data Management and Standardization Techniques: Understanding how to collect, clean, and standardize clinical data is foundational. The certificate program equips learners with the knowledge of best practices for data management, including how to use standardized terminologies and coding systems like ICD-10, SNOMED, and RxNorm. These skills are crucial for ensuring that data is consistent and usable across different healthcare providers and systems.
2. Statistical and Analytical Proficiency: Proficiency in statistical methods and analytical tools is essential. The program covers various statistical techniques and analytical models that are commonly used in clinical research and healthcare analytics, such as regression analysis, machine learning algorithms, and predictive modeling. Learners will also gain hands-on experience with data visualization tools and software like Python, R, and SQL.
3. Interdisciplinary Collaboration: Effective communication and collaboration across diverse teams, from clinical staff to IT professionals and researchers, are vital. The certificate program emphasizes the importance of effective communication and teamwork, providing learners with the skills to bridge the gap between clinical and technical teams.
4. Ethics and Regulatory Compliance: Handling patient data comes with significant ethical and legal responsibilities. The program covers best practices for ensuring data privacy, security, and compliance with regulations like HIPAA and GDPR. Understanding these regulations is crucial for maintaining trust and ensuring the integrity of the data.
Best Practices for Standardizing Clinical Data
Standardizing clinical data is not just about coding and organizing data; it’s about creating a system that supports evidence-based decision-making. Here are some best practices that the certificate program encourages:
1. Adopt a Data Governance Framework: Implementing a robust data governance framework ensures that data quality is maintained throughout the lifecycle of the data. This includes establishing clear roles and responsibilities, setting data quality standards, and establishing a process for data validation and certification.
2. Leverage Electronic Health Records (EHRs): EHRs are a treasure trove of clinical data. By effectively integrating and standardizing data from EHRs, organizations can enhance patient care and improve outcomes. The program teaches learners how to extract meaningful insights from EHR data and how to use it to inform clinical decisions.
3. Utilize Interoperability Standards: Interoperability standards like FHIR (Fast Healthcare Interoperability Resources) enable seamless exchange of clinical data between different systems. The certificate program emphasizes the importance of interoperability and provides learners with the tools and knowledge to implement these standards.
4. Continuous Improvement and Feedback Loop: Establishing a continuous improvement cycle ensures that the data management processes are refined over time. The program encourages the use of feedback loops, where data quality metrics are regularly reviewed and used to identify areas for improvement.
